Brick Hardscaping in Greenwich, CT
Brick hardscaping services encompass the design, installation, and repair of durable outdoor features made from brick materials. Common projects include creating pat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and garden borders that enhance both the functionality and visual appeal of residential properties. Homeowners often seek information about the types of brick options available, the durability of different designs, and the overall maintenance requirements to ensure their outdoor spaces remain attractive and long-lasting.
Before requesting brick hardscaping services,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, including site preparation, material selection, and the overall process timeline. It’s also helpful to consider the style and layout that complement the existing landscape, as well as any local regulations or property restrictions that might influence the project. Clear communication about these aspects can support a smooth planning process and help achieve results that meet aesthetic preferences and practical needs.

Common Brick Hardscaping Jobs
Brick patios - durable outdoor surfaces that enhance backyard functionality and curb appeal.
Brick walkways - practical paths that provide safe, attractive routes through gardens and yards.
Retaining walls - sturdy structures that manage slopes and prevent soil erosion around the property.
Brick steps - safe and stylish stairways for entryways and garden access points.
Fire pits and outdoor fireplaces - inviting features built with brick to create cozy outdoor gatherings.
Brick edging and borders - clean, defined edges that improve landscape organization and appearance.
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ping is ideal for patios, walkways, retaining walls, and decorative features around a property.
How long does brick hardscaping typically last? When properly installed, brick hardscaping can last for decades with minimal maintenance.
Are brick hardscaping options customizable? Yes, different brick patterns, colors, and layouts can be tailored to complement various property styles.
What are common benefits of brick hardscaping? Brick features add durability, timeless appeal, and increased property value to outdoor spaces.
